ST. MARYS, WV 26170 The 2008 Winter Training Series,
hosted by the Dewey Avenue church of Christ is scheduled to begin
Thursday, January 3 and continue each Thursday evening from 7:00
9:00 PM. The list of topics and teachers this year include: Early
Church History III, taught by Bruce Daugherty; Ephesians taught
by Paola DiLuca; The United Kingdom, taught by Dan Kessinger;
The World of the Bible, taught by Eddie Melott; Morality
and Ethics, taught by Roger Rush; and World Religions,
taught by Dana Slingluff. For more information, contact Dan Kessinger,
701 Dewey Ave. (304) 684-3939.
BRIDGEPORT, WV 26330 The 2008 One-Day Lectureship,
hosted by the Bridgeport church of Christ is scheduled for Sunday,
January 6, 2008. The speakers and their subjects will be: Ryan
Currey, Another Year of Learning: The Benefits of Bible Study;
Denver Cooper, Another Year with God: Including God in Your
Plans; Brent Gallagher, Another Year of Mercies: Faithfulness
and Mercy of God; Steve Snider, Another Year of Service:
Work for the Master. Lunch following the 2nd Session at the
Benedum Civic Center. For more information, contact John Board.
(304) 842 6738. Corner of Philadelphia & Center.
HENDERSON, TN 38340-2399 The 72nd Annual Bible
Lectureship at Freed-Hardeman University is scheduled for February
3-8, 2008. The theme will be, "Behold the Lamb: John's
Gospel of Belief." A dinner, honoring the life and work
of Milton and Laurel Sewell is scheduled for Tuesday, Feb. 5,
5-6:30 PM. For more information, contact David Lipe. (731) 989
6622. www.fhu.edu/lectureship
